The NVX tweets fit just fine, and are half the cost of the Arc version for (literally) the exact same driver. I just shaved down the posts and a few other plastic bits on the tweeter grille, took the metal grille off the tweeter, and fabricated a 3D printed mount to hold them in place. Looks 100% stock. The passenger side has tons of room behind it, and the driver side pushes slightly against the CCF I have on the door.
Other than that, I have some Stereo Integrity TM65 mkIIs in the stock locations, and a 10" Sundown SD-3 in the passenger footwell, all being powered by an Alpine PDX-V9. It gets loud enough to completely drown out road and wind noise at 70 with the top down, but is smooth enough to think that you can talk over it...until you try.
